Evening Union Skills Courses
The Washington State Labor Education and Research Center (LERC) provides classes and workshops to union members explicitly aimed at helping them play bigger roles in their union. This includes classes on essential skills, including 1:1 organizing, planning campaigns, handling grievances, and participating in bargaining. Individuals who have completed LERC trainings have often gone on to get elected as stewards, board members, and have led campaigns and committees.
The LERC’s courses are typically offered hybrid, both in-person at South Seattle College’s Georgetown Campus, and online, reaching participants across Washington and the Pacific Northwest.
